Cal. Water Code § 11842

Investment and Use of Surplus Money

Applied in 1 court decision — leading case 60 Cal. 2d 579 - Warne v. Harkness (1963)

Most recently applied in 60 Cal. 2d 579 - Warne v. Harkness (December 1963)

Amended by Stats. 1957, Ch. 1932.

If the proceedings authorizing the issuance of bonds do not require surplus revenues to be held or applied in any particular manner, they shall be allocated and used for such other purposes incidental to the construction, operation, and maintenance of the project and for making necessary replacements thereto as the department may determine.
